Dinosaur from Montana had horns like Norse god Loki’s blades

By Will Dunham WASHINGTON (Reuters) – About 78 million years ago in what was then a subtropical coastal plain – now the badlands of northern Montana – lived a four-legged plant-eating dinosaur built a bit like a rhinoceros with a fabulously ornate set of horns on its head.
